Brokers hit harder than insurers, says CBI/PwC survey

PwC

Insurance brokers’ profitability dropped back after an unexpectedly strong fall in the volume of business and value of premium income, according to the latest PwC survey for the Confederation of British Industry.

Total operating costs fell, but the decline in volumes was sufficiently steep to push average costs per transaction up strongly.
